Lutein has been proved to have the ability to remove singlet oxygen groups and peroxide radicals, and it protects human retina from injury through blue-light infiltration and antioxidation. Although the validity of lutein to prevent or treat various eye diseases has been revealed by clinical trials, the exact mechanism is not definitely known, which leaves room for clinical and laboratory researches. The laboratory research progress of roles and mechanisms of lutein in eye diseases is reviewed in this paper, and major eye diseasesassociated animal models and cells in laboratory researches for lutein are introduced.
